Ola Electric Mobility has officially launched its qualified institutional placement (QIP) and set a floor price of Rs 37.74 per share. According to the company's regulatory filing, the board may offer a discount of up to 5% on this floor price. The final issue price and the total amount to be raised will be determined through the book-building process, which involves soliciting bids from institutional investors. The QIP allows Ola Electric to raise funds from qualified institutional buyers without issuing a public prospectus. The floor price is based on the company's recent stock trading levels as per SEBI guidelines. The fundraise is expected to support the electric two-wheeler maker's capital expenditure, working capital requirements, and general corporate purposes. Market participants will closely watch the book-building process to gauge institutional appetite for the company's shares. The discount of up to 5% provides flexibility to attract investors in the current market environment. Ola Electric has been expanding its manufacturing capacity and dealer network in India's rapidly growing electric vehicle market. The floor price of Rs 37.74 per share may reflect the company's current valuation expectations based on recent trading activity. The ability to offer up to a 5% discount could help the company attract sufficient institutional interest, especially if market conditions are volatile. For existing shareholders, the QIP could lead to dilution of their stake, depending on the final size of the issue. However, the fresh capital infusion may strengthen Ola Electric's balance sheet and fund its growth initiatives. The company has been investing in a new manufacturing plant in Tamil Nadu (the "Future Factory") and expanding its product portfolio beyond electric scooters. The success of this QIP may serve as an indicator of institutional confidence in India's electric vehicle sector. Competitors like Ather Energy and Bajaj Auto also compete in the same space, making capital access critical for market share battles. The book-building process will reveal the pricing that investors find fair. From an investment perspective, the QIP introduces both opportunities and risks. The final issue price could be at a discount to the prevailing market price, potentially offering an attractive entry point for institutional investors. For retail investors, the dilution effect may weigh on earnings per share in the near term, though the capital infusion could drive long-term value if deployed effectively. The broader outlook for Ola Electric hinges on its ability to scale production, manage costs, and maintain its leadership in India's electric two-wheeler market. The QIP proceeds would likely be used to accelerate these plans. However, competitive pressures, regulatory changes, and supply chain dynamics could impact the company's growth trajectory. Other EV makers and auto companies raising funds through similar routes may set a precedent for capital market activity in the sector. Investors should consider the company's financial health, market position, and the final QIP terms before making any decisions.
